The Little Pot Boiler is Spike Milligan is a loose limbed little book full of short pieces, sketches, observations, and jokes that feel improvised but are doing real work. Like the best nonsense. It’s humour that is all at once anarchic, anti-authoritarian, suspicious of seriousness while being very aware of it.
This is mid-century British comic writing before it calcified into panel shows. It's strange, fast, slightly irritated with the world, and allergic to polish.

First published 1963. This copy is a Universal–Tandem paperback, later printing (mid-to-late 1960s / early 70s run). Not a true first, but still an early, culturally relevant edition. Solid spine, clean text block, bit of toning, no obvious structural damage. This is a reading + collecting copy, not a fragile relic.
